Kaputir ward sits in Turkana South sub-county, Turkana County, home to about 15,119 people. Working from Turkana County soil averages, the profile is pH 8.0 (alkaline), nitrogen 0.41 g/kg, phosphorus 38.5 mg/kg and potassium 417.0 mg/kg. The alkaline pH can restrict micronutrient uptake, so watch for zinc and iron deficiency. Based on this soil, the strongest-scoring crops for Kaputir are Sisal, Green Grams, and Sorghum — see the full ranking below.
